Athree-phase, 440-V, 60-Hz, four-pole induction motor operates at a slip of 0.025 at full load, with its rotor circuit short-circuited. This motor is to be operated on a 50-Hz supply so that the air-gap ?ux wave has the same amplitude at the same torque as on a 60-Hz supply. Determine the 50- Hz applied voltage and the slip atwhich themotor will develop a torque equal to its 60-Hz full-load value.
